Tata Steel has confirmed it will close two Welsh blast furnaces and cut up to 2,800 jobs

Port Talbot steelworks: blast furnaces to close, costing up to 2,800 jobs

The issue of how to decarbonise economies has been a theme at Davos this week.

Chrystia Freeland, Canada’s finance minister, told delegates she discussed this issue with a very significant international business leader who’s also a big investor in Canada:

“And he said to me, all the countries in the world need to be very careful that decarbonisation does not mean deindustrialization.

I thought that was an extremely smart comment.

“Steel production is an energy-intensive and environmentally impactful process. The cut in energy supplies to Europe from Russia has led to the deindustrialisation of Europe in general.

The Russian energy supplies were redirected to India.
